## Webhook Retry Semantics — Contacts

Flarepost retries failed webhook deliveries five times with exponential backoff, capped at 30 minutes. After the fifth failure, the endpoint is paused and a notice is queued. Do not ask the platform team to tune per-customer retry counts; that's owned by the Delivery squad under the Kestrel initiative. Escalations about dropped deliveries go to Mira Oduya's group. For retry semantics questions raised at this sync, send them here first.

escalation mailbox, yajef-hawef: druix@qirvancorp.internal

**Action Item PM-14:** The Ledgerline billing worker must move to blue-green deploys before the next invoicing cycle. During the outage, an in-place restart dropped mid-flight charge events, and replays took four hours. Staging already has the dual-pool config; production needs the traffic-switch hook and a rollback drill signed off by the Tallowgate release team. The full cutover checklist is documented on the internal page below.

operations page: https://jenkins.zemvarcloud.local/job/merge_requests/repo/build/73930b4b30f0a8ed

Finance Review Summary — Marketing Spend, Torvane Instruments

Prepared for the incoming director. The 18% marketing budget reduction was applied across the Pellworth and Greyfen regions, with agency fees renegotiated and the Skylark sponsorship discontinued. Forecast savings total roughly one-sixth of annual commercial spend, though brand-tracking costs were retained deliberately. Variance reporting moves to monthly. The rationale behind these choices is set out in the note below.

confidential, kagup-bafog: Fraaxax Group is in early talks to buy Soroxox Group for about $343.8 million. The Olidor launch date is June 14, and nothing goes to the press before then. Legal wants the Aldmirek Logistics term sheet signed before July 23.